Is WordPress free to use?

WordPress the CMS software is free to use. In fact, you can also find 1000’s of free WordPress themes and plugins to set up your site as well on WordPress.org.

WordPress CMS is open source. In fact, you can use WordPress and have your site hosted on WordPress.com or you can self-host it on any number of Web Hosting Providers.

However, you would still need to pay for web hosting so your WordPress website is online and accessible through the internet. Although you can usually find a Web Host that will host your WordPress website on a Shared Web Hosting plan for as little as $5-$10 per month on average.

The only exception to paid hosting is if you create a WordPress blog or website on WordPress.com through their “Free Blog” plan. Other costs for using WordPress can include using premium themes and plugins should you decide to do so.

Is WordPress hosting free or paid?

WordPress Hosting on WordPress.com is both free and paid. WordPress.com has a free blog plan, but WordPress.com offers many Managed WordPress paid plans as well. 

You can also self-host your WordPress website on various Web Hosting Providers too. However, most if not all, are not free, but they do offer a variety of affordable paid plans that you can choose from.

How can I create a WordPress website for free?

The easiest way to create a WordPress website for free and to have it live on the internet is through WordPress.com free plan. 

However, you can actually create your own WordPress website right on your laptop. You can simply download the WordPress CMS from WordPress.org and choose from thousands of themes and plugins both free and paid.

If you are new to WordPress you can get to know the word press CMS while developing your WordPress website right on your laptop. Here is a post on how to download WordPress on your laptop using free software, “Can I build a WordPress site without hosting? You bet you can!”.

Is a WordPress domain free?

If you have a free or even paid WordPress hosting plan on WordPress.com then the WordPress.com domain name you are given with your URL does come free. 

However, if you were to get your own custom domain name, then it’s not free. But you can pick up custom domain names for as little as $10 or $15. This will allow you to have your own custom domain name without WordPress in the URL.

Is the Wix free version better or is the WordPress free version better?

In all honesty, despite the name of this website, I can say that the Wix free version is neither better nor worse than the WordPress free version. When I’m talking about the WordPress free version, of course I’m referring to WordPress.com’s free blog plan. 

When you consider what both offer and the limitations of both free plans on Wix and WordPress it is pretty difficult to differentiate them.

However, this is a big “however”, WordPress is open source. Wix is closed source. So you can literally start a free WordPress blog on WordPress.com and once you get to know the CMS and build something with it, you can either move up to one of WordPress.com’s paid plans which will give you much more flexibility or you can move it and self-host on any number of Web Hosting Providers. 

On the other hand, with Wix, you can upgrade your free plan to one of Wix paid plans, but you can’t move your Wix site off the Wix hosting platform.

Is WordPress free with GoDaddy?

WordPress is not only free with GoDaddy, it is free with most, if not all, Web Hosting Providers on the internet today. 

In fact, many Web Hosting Providers now allow for quick downloading of the WordPress CMS right into your Web Hosting account’s dashboard. You can then choose from thousands of free themes and plugins from WordPress to get started.

Can I get a domain for free with WordPress?

Normally, the only free domain name you can get with WordPress.com includes WordPress.com in the URL. 

However, there are many Web Hosting Providers that will include a domain for free with some of their hosting packages. Although, you will be then obliged to pay for that hosting package for one year at least.

Can free WordPress blogs make money?

Although free WordPress blogs do have some limitations as far as monetization is concerned, you can still make money with a free WordPress blog. How?

You can insert affiliate links to any products that you wish to sell or promote in your free WordPress blog.

In addition, if you offer any products or services offline, you can use your WordPress blog to promote those products and services. 

However, if you wish to sell products online from your WordPress blog or website, you would need to change your free WordPress blog plan to one of WordPress’s paid plans. Or move it to another Web Hosting Provider and self-host it there.

Can I change my domain name on WordPress?

If you have WordPress.com’s free blog plan, you will receive a domain name with “WordPress.com” included in the URL. 

If you want to change your domain name to a custom domain name, you will need to buy your domain name from WordPress.com and either upgrade your hosting plan to one of WordPress.com paid versions. 

Or you can buy a custom domain name from any domain name registrar and self-host your website on any number of Independent Web Hosting Providers. 

Where can I get a WordPress free download?

You can get a WordPress free download from WordPress.org or you can self-host your website from a Web Hosting Provider. You can normally access free WordPress downloads right from your Web Hosting Provider’s dashboard for your account.
